Succession Act, 1925 — Section 224: Grant of probate to several executors simultaneously or at different times

224. Grant of probate to several executors simultaneously or at different times. When several executors are appointed, probate may be granted to them all simultaneously or at different times. Illustration A is an executor of B’s will by express appointment and C an executor of it by implication. Probate may be granted to A and C at the same time or to A first and then to C, or to C first and then to A.
